Wye Tennis Club
Founded in 1971 and now home to over 400 members
Wye Tennis Club has fantastic facilities and a thriving membership. It's always a pleasure to play Wye in the village leagues.
Wye Tennis club is located at Wye Playing Fields, by the village hall, Bridge Street, Wye, TN25 5EA. There is ample parking for all cars.
There are two clay courts and three tar macadam courts. Four of the courts are floodlit and one non-floodlit court with a rebound wall. Facilities at the club include disabled toilets, a kitchen area and separate changing rooms.
Wye Tennis Club received the Kent LTA Club of the Year Award in 2013 as well as being awarded the ‘Long Trophy’ presented by the Parish Council to the organisation that has made a big impact on village life.
Coaching is available to all experienced or non experienced players. Junior coaching is also provided at the tennis courts.
